Mina Moiseyev, 1882, (1939). A Russian peasant painted from life. Ivan Kramskoy (1837-1887) initiated the revolt of fourteen at the St Petersburg Academy of Arts, a reaction against academic art which led to the expulsion of a group of graduates who went on to establish the Artel of Artists, an artists cooperative commune. Painting in the collection of The State Russian Museum, St Petersburg, Russia. From " The Russian State Museum". [State Art Publishers, Moscow and Leningrad, 1939]
